Santa Rosa

TrueTime signs for long time

Brian Eisberg and Matt Krupp of Orion Partners Ltd. guided TrueTime Inc. through negotiations for a 15-year lease for 70,281 square feet in Westwind Business Park. The building, at 3750 Westwind Blvd., is in construction. The developer of both the park and the project is Brondi Development.
